I've gotten a build of 2.0.9, but I haven't tested it unlike the 32-bit build, 
but they are the same except for some settings in Visual Studio. Oh and I had 
to give up on getting OpenPGM to work as its windows support is very bad and 
its 64-bit support is even worse. It depends on GCC extensions which is the 
biggest problem. I was unable to make compatible OpenPGM DLLs for my stuff (I 
needed them without buffer security and without wchar_t as a native type to be 
compatible with Qt).

What problems are you having aside from anything to do with OpenPGM?
